I had Oracle 9i on Redhat 9 but I have now gone to Redhat Enterprise Linux 3. There is a bug when I try to start runInstaller (message below). Oracle says to apply bug patch 3006854 (which provides rhel3_pre_install.sh), but they don't say where to get it. It is apparently on metalink, but I don't have a support contract.
Does anyone know how I can get bug patch 3006854 or rhel3_pre_install.sh ?
The error message, upon starting runInstaller was: Initializing Java Virtual Machine from
/tmp/OraInstall2003-11-27_06-09-15PM/jre/bin/java. Please wait... Error occurred during initialization of VM Unable to load native library:
/tmp/OraInstall2003-11-27_06-09-15PM/jre/lib/i386/libjava.so:
symbol __libc_wait, version GLIBC_2.0 not defined in file libc.so.6 with link time reference
